Apple’s iPhone has reached a level where it has outsold all smartphones in the U.S., according to research group iSuppli. The Apple iPhone cellphone during its first full month of sales accounted for 1.8 percent of all U.S. cellphone handset sales. The research firm iSuppli forecasts that Apple would sell 4.5 million iPhones for 2007. Sales should rise to more than 30 million units by 2011.

Real estate brokers and agents now have an option to assign and route leads with the Apple iPhone cellphone. A La Mode, a real estate web site and software company have released iPhone compatible real estate software that integrates with their XSites product. They have been billed as the first company to provide any kind of real estate software for the Apple iPhone. This software also allows the routing of leads from a broker to an agent and then on to another agent if they happen to be busy at the time. Their web site says the lead travels in a round-robin type fashion to equally assign leads throughout the sales process.
